Embark on an inspiring journey through this TEDx talk as renowned Indian costume designer and fashion stylist Neeta Lulla shares her experiences and insights from decades in the industry. Discover the power of unconventional choices, creative ingenuity, and unwavering resolve as Lulla weaves a narrative of success through adaptability, self-reliance, and continuous learning. Gain valuable lessons on embracing diversity, fostering enthusiasm, and practicing self-discipline to craft your own unique path in life. Reflect on your aspirations, obstacles, and opportunities while drawing inspiration from Lulla's extraordinary resilience and commitment to excellence in her prolific career spanning over 400 films and iconic costume designs.
